Egress Window Installation : Safety and Value for Your Basement
Thinking about upgrading/enhancing/improving your basement? An egress window can add a major touch of value to your house/boost the worth of your home/increase the selling price of your property. Besides providing a great return on your investment, these windows are also crucial for your safety and well-being in case of an emergency. An egress window provides a safe and legal escape route from your basement, ensuring compliance with building codes.
- Prior to installation, consider the configuration of the window.
- A skilled installer can help you choose the right size and location for your basement.
Considering an egress window is a great idea. Not only does it increase your property's worth, but it also ensures safety and peace of mind.
Revitalize Your Basement with Natural Light
Don't let your basement languish in perpetual gloom! Through a few strategic strategies, you can convert this often-neglected space into a bright and inviting haven. Start by maximizing natural light. Explore adding skylights or large windows to inject sunshine into the space.
- Enhance this with strategically placed artificial lighting, such as adjustable fixtures and task lights.
- Incorporate light-colored paint on the walls and ceiling to bounce existing light.
- Accessorize with mirrored surfaces to further brighten the space.
With a little creativity, your basement can become a favorite spot in your home.
